Continuously Variable Transmissions (CVT) represent sophisticated technology that requires specialized knowledge and proper maintenance procedures. Unlike traditional automatic transmissions, CVTs operate on entirely different principles, using belt or chain systems with variable pulleys rather than fixed gear sets.

CVT fluid is not interchangeable with traditional automatic transmission fluid. Nissan’s NS-2 and NS-3 fluids have specific friction characteristics essential for the belt or chain to grip the pulleys properly. Using incorrect fluid, even temporarily, can cause immediate damage or accelerated wear.
The fluid in a CVT does more than lubricate – it must maintain precise friction properties throughout its service life. This is why CVT fluid degrades differently than traditional transmission fluid and requires more frequent replacement, especially in the demanding conditions of Texas driving.

While traditional automatics might go 60,000-100,000 miles between services, CVTs require more frequent attention. Professional service providers typically recommend CVT fluid service around 30,000 miles for vehicles driven in severe conditions like North Texas. This interval accounts for our heat, stop-and-go traffic, and the stress these factors place on the transmission.
The cost difference between preventive maintenance and CVT replacement makes regular service economically sensible. Fluid service might cost a few hundred dollars, while CVT replacement can exceed $4,000. This dramatic difference makes the 30,000-mile service interval a wise investment.

We use the drain-and-fill method recommended for Nissan CVTs, ensuring the correct amount of proper specification fluid. We use fluids meeting manufacturer specifications, depending on your specific model requirements.
Temperature is critical during CVT service. The fluid must be at proper operating temperature for accurate level checking. Too much or too little fluid can both cause transmission damage. Our technicians understand these precise requirements.

Texas heat accelerates CVT fluid degradation. Temperatures exceeding 100°F are common in Denton summers, pushing transmission temperatures higher than in moderate climates. This heat breaks down fluid additives faster, reducing protective properties.
Stop-and-go traffic on I-35E or Loop 288 generates additional heat. Unlike highway driving where airflow provides cooling, traffic creates heat buildup that stresses the transmission. Understanding these local factors explains why we recommend 30,000-mile service intervals.
